| Obverse description | Printed in violet, the obverse carries a central vignette of Angkor Wat temple complex at left, rendered in fine intaglio line work with palm trees and a reflecting pool in the foreground. The bank title BANQUE DE L'INDOCHINE arches across the top in bold letterpress, with DIX PIASTRES in large guilloche-framed text below, and the numeral 10 repeated at each corner. Two signature panels for LE PRESIDENT and LE DIRECTEUR GENERAL ADJT. appear above a legal warning text in small print at the lower centre, with a blank circular watermark area at right. |

| Reverse description | Printed in rose, the reverse centres on a vignette of a rice farmer carrying bundles of harvested grain, set against a rural landscape with mountains in the background. The bank title BANQUE DE L'INDOCHINE runs across the top, with the Vietnamese inscription GIAY MUOI DONG below it, flanked by the denomination rendered in Khmer and Chinese characters at left and right respectively. The value $10 appears in a decorative panel at lower right, with a blank circular watermark area at left. |
